WEST VIRGINIA (LOOTPRESS) – During remarks delivered Thursday, Governor Patrick Morrisey paused to acknowledge the profound grief felt across West Virginia following the death of Sarah Beckm, who was killed in what authorities have described as an unprovoked attack. Her funeral was held Tuesday, drawing an outpouring of support from across the state.

“We’re all going to remember Sarah for a very, very long time,” the Governor said, describing her as a courageous woman whose loss continues to resonate deeply. The ceremony honoring her life was called “incredibly moving,” with many West Virginians expected to cherish her memory for years to come.
